IdentityTruth sounds much like a Faces of The Nation report or what some "info brokers" refer to as a "Comp" or Comprehensive Report - for $50. you get about 12 pages of a subject's previous address, neighbors, possible relatives, friends, prior jobs, a stab at criminal history (sorry no pun intended), and lots of useless information some include, GASP, a real satellite photo of the subjects house (from Google Earth). As for Lifelock, they leave a lot to be desired, and I spend a lot of time researching them - take a look at Debix, cheaper, seems better, and they have a fun demo page you can use to scare your friends into thinking their ID has been compromised - - Debix.com .

There is a lot of interesting data bases and services out there, but it takes some serious vetting to make sure you are not throwing your money or your confidential information away!

Identity Truth is owned by Provell, Inc which does business by many names, one of which is WC Value Plus. GOOGLE these names and see the accusations against this company due to fraudulent credit card charges. You may think twice about trusting this company with your private information.
